Valmie Resources (VMRI) V-1 Drone Successfully Completes Maiden Flight, Marks Major Milestone

DENVER, CO / ACCESSWIRE / April 14, 2015 / Valmie Resources Inc. (OTCMKTS: VMRI) today announces it has reached a major milestone as its V-1 Drone prototype successfully completed its first flight. The landmark unmanned aerial vehicle (UAV) lifted off from the test site while the engineering team on the ground closely monitored its progress and data stream.

While in the air, the crew performed numerous assessments such as testing the calibration of the flight controller, evaluating handling characteristics at a variety of speeds, and testing the data being analyzed by the onboard data capturing system.

One of Valmie’s focus areas is agriculture, among the most promising applications for UAV’s. Data-hungry farm operators are seeking on-demand information in very high resolution on a frequent, continual basis. UAV technology, already in use throughout many areas of the world, helps growers’ constant efforts to efficiently monitor their fields, mitigate crop stressors and manage crop development. Valmie’s V-1 Drone is being developed to be used with a number of different “plug and play” imaging sensors, including thermal (infrared) and hyperspectral to collect field data visible and not visible to the human eye. These different sensors and algorithms allow operators to hone in on specific problems or information such as soil moisture or crop disease, for example, in the case of growers.

Along with the V-1 Drone, Valmie is in the process of developing its first-generation Software as a Service (SaaS) AIMD Platform. The AIMD Platform is Valmie’s proprietary end-to-end solution designed to collect and send data from the unmanned vehicles’ independent controller units back to a cloud-based modular resource network for aggregation and analysis. This platform will give drones and other unmanned vehicles improved communication abilities with remote hubs and other mobile devices. The AIMD Platform will have the capability to determine intervention thresholds, quickly route predetermined responses, communicate critical information to the operator, and in some cases deploy solutions in real time.
